Join acclaimed author Annabel Smith for a workshop all about character. In this workshop, Annabel will share insightful tips and tools to help create more complex, relatable and interesting characters. You’ll also learn:
- The relationship between character & narrative voice
- The two most important elements of character
- How character drives plot
- The relationship between dialogue & character
- Managing characters’ back stories
This workshops is best suited to fiction writers, especially those writing or planning to write longer works (novellas & novels).

Collapse BioAnnabel Smith is the author of interactive digital novel/app The Ark, US bestseller Whisky Charlie Foxtrot, and A New Map of the Universe, which was shortlisted for the WA Premier’s Book Awards. She is an Australia Council Creative Australia Fellow, holds a PhD in Writing & teaches writing around Australia.
